Frances Eileen Ruttinger

Frances Eileen (Morrissey) Evans Ruttinger, age 95, passed away on May 2nd, at Life Care Center in Osawatomie, Kansas.

Eileen was born May 24, 1919 in Frankfort, Kansas, the daughter of Francis Edwin and Esther Ann McCarthy Morrissey. She attended grade school in Turner, Kansas and Eudora, Kansas and graduated from St. Joseph High School in Shawnee, Kansas in 1937. She attended St. Mary’s College in Lansing, where she majored in nursing, graduating as a Registered Nurse through Providence Hospital School of Nursing in Kansas City, Kansas in June 1941.

Eileen worked 42 years as a registered nurse at multiple hospitals in Kansas City, KS, as well as Kansas City, MO. She was also a private duty nurse for many patients, including a Kansas state senator. The last 12 years of her nursing career she worked as a school nurse in Linn and Miami County, Kansas and at the Kansas State Hospital in Osawatomie, KS.

Eileen married Lieut. Frederick C. Evans on August 31, 1943 in Newton, Kansas. He died September 20, 1945. They had three children, twins James W. and John E. Evans, and daughter Judith A. Evans. Eileen married Lewis M. Ruttinger February 28, 1948 in Ottawa, Kansas. He died November 9, 2003. They had three children, Stephen M., Teviot M. and Robert L. Ruttinger. Eileen was also preceded in death by two brothers and her parents.

Eileen is survived by sons John Evans, James Evans and wife Hoko, daughter Judith Evans; and by sons, Stephen Ruttinger and wife Eunice, Teviot Ruttinger, and Robert Ruttinger and wife Jeanette and each of their respective families which include 10 grandchildren, 4 living and 1 deceased great-grandchildren and 1 great-great grandchild. Eileen is also survived by her sister Mary M. West and her brothers Francis E. Morrissey, Jr. and Philip D. Morrissey, as well as many nieces and nephews.

Eileen retired from her nursing career in 1983 to enjoy her wide variety of eclectic hobbies which included embroidery, reading, antiquing, travels to Ireland, rock collecting, her garden, and visiting her grown children and their families.
